What Is Stranger Than Heaven?
Stranger Than Heaven is a narrative-driven exploration game with puzzle elements, set in a surreal realm that exists somewhere between life and the unknown. You awaken in a place that isn’t quite Earth, but isn’t quite gone either.
You don’t know who you are.
You don’t know why you’re here.
But the world does—and it’s watching.
Think: Journey meets Inside, with the emotional weight of Gris and the tone of a lucid dream.
Gameplay Features
Non-linear Exploration
Navigate dreamlike landscapes shaped by emotion—floating cities, fading forests, endless stairways, and memory-fractured reflections.
Symbolic Puzzles
Solve logic challenges that connect to the character’s forgotten past. Each puzzle solved is a memory recovered—or relived.
Emotionally Reactive Dialogue
Silent choices and reactions shape the tone of the narrative. There are no dialogue trees—just presence, perception, and consequence.
Abstract Art Design
Soft palettes, ethereal lighting, and shifting architecture immerse players in a liminal world both haunting and peaceful.
Ambient Soundtrack
An emotionally driven score underscores each environment, shifting based on progress and player state.
